What Are The Key Features?
Instantly discovers all devices currently connected to the local network with a one-tap interface.
Identifies unknown users or potential unauthorized devices connected to the network.
Provides access to router admin settings and a database of default passwords to facilitate security updates.
Includes a Ping tool for connectivity testing and a Port Scanner to analyze open ports on connected devices.
